ByrdAdatto is a nationally recognized boutique law firm specializing in business and healthcare law. With more than 13 attorneys and offices in Dallas and Chicago, we are currently seeking a Transactional Attorney to join our team. The ideal candidate will have 0–3 years of experience, strong organizational and communication skills, and a collaborative, team-oriented mindset.

Associate-Attorney Job Description:
The ideal candidate for this position will have 0–3 years of experience in general corporate transactional matters, including entity formation, contract drafting and negotiation, corporate governance, and business structuring. Additional experience or interest in healthcare transactional work, insurance laws and HIPAA compliance, due diligence investigations, and healthcare regulatory matters is a plus but not required.

Duties and Responsibilities:
• Draft, review, and negotiate a wide variety of commercial agreements to support ongoing business operations, including service contracts, vendor agreements, non-disclosure agreements, and collaborative business arrangements.
• Provide legal support for business transactions with a focus on healthcare-related entities.
• Conduct and manage legal due diligence for transactional matters, identifying risks and providing actionable recommendations.
• Collaborate with cross-functional teams to develop practical, business-oriented legal solutions that align with organizational objectives and healthcare regulations.

Requirements and Qualifications:
• Juris Doctor with strong academic record
• Qualified candidates must be and remain licensed to practice law and in good standing in Texas
• 0-3 years of relevant experience
• Excellent research, analytic, writing, and communication skills
• Effective and efficient problem-solving capabilities with the ability to work independently and proactively, and to develop creative solutions to meet client and team needs
• Strong attention to detail
• Ability to manage multiple projects with competing priorities and to follow through and meet deadlines

Additional Information:
Employment Type: Full-Time
Work Environment: This position operates in a professional office environment.
Compensation for this position includes competitive salary, health insurance, paid time off, bar dues and CLE’s paid, and 401K.
Work Locations: Primary location is Dallas, Texas.
